Staying Hydrated

Hydration is key to unlocking your full potential during workouts. Even mild dehydration can significantly impair physical performance, leading to fatigue, reduced endurance, and decreased motivation. Make it a habit to drink water regularly throughout the day, especially before, during, and after exercise. Aim to consume at least eight glasses of water daily, and adjust your intake based on factors such as exercise intensity, duration, and environmental conditions.

Warming Up Properly

A proper warm-up is essential for preparing your body and mind for intense exercise. Dynamic stretches, light cardio, and mobility exercises help increase blood flow to muscles, improve joint flexibility, and enhance neuromuscular activation. Spend 5-10 minutes performing dynamic movements that mimic the activities you’ll be doing during your workout. This primes your muscles and reduces the risk of injury, allowing you to perform at your best from the start.

Maximizing Efficiency: Supersets and Circuits

To make the most of your time at the gym, consider incorporating supersets and circuits into your full body workout routine. Supersets involve performing two exercises back-to-back with minimal rest in between, targeting different muscle groups to maximize efficiency and intensity. Circuits, on the other hand, involve completing a series of exercises consecutively with little to no rest, providing a cardiovascular challenge while still building strength. Experiment with different combinations to keep your workouts engaging and effective.

Boosting Metabolism and Burning Calories

Another advantage of full body workouts is their ability to boost metabolism and burn calories long after the workout is over. By challenging the body with high-intensity exercises, these workouts create an “afterburn” effect known as excess post-exercise oxygen consumption (EPOC). This means that even after the workout is finished, the body continues to burn calories at an elevated rate, helping women achieve their weight loss goals more efficiently.
